The Associated Press is reporting the comedian/actor Bernie Mac passed away early Saturday morning due to complications with pneumonia. He has been in the hospital for the last few weeks dealing with the sickness and at one point was reported as doing well. I first remember Bernie Mac when when he appeared on Def Comedy Jam.
Bernie Mac had his own sitcom, “The Bernie Mac Show,” from 2001-2006 and stared in several movies including the Ocean’s 11 series and Charlie’s Angels. Mac was born Bernard Jeffrey McCullough on Oct. 5, 1957, in Chicago. He grew up on the city’s South Side, living with his mother and grandparents. His grandfather was the deacon of a Baptist church.
In his 2004 memoir, “Maybe You Never Cry Again,” Mac wrote about having a poor childhood – eating bologna for dinner – and a strict, no-nonsense upbringing.
